US FDA Approves First At-Home Test for Cervical Cancer Screening
(Reuters) -The U.S. Food and Drug Administration has approved the first at-home test for cervical cancer screening, its maker Teal Health said on Friday, offering an alternative to Pap smears that need to be undertaken at a doctor's office.
